What Exactly is Slot Volatility?
In the simplest terms, volatility refers to the risk level associated with a specific slot game. It describes how often a game pays out and how large those payouts typically are. Low Volatility Slots: The Steady Stream
Low variance slots are designed for players who prefer a more stable experience. These games tend to deliver frequent wins, although the payout amounts are generally smaller. High Volatility Slots: The High-Stakes Thrill
On the opposite end of the spectrum are high variance slots. These games are the “all or nothing” options of the 900 bet casino. In these games, you might go through long periods without any wins at all. However, when a win does occur, it is often significantly larger, frequently triggering massive multipliers or huge bonus rounds.
